| Definition | : |
Thessalonica = "victory of falsity" 1) a famous and populous city, situated on the Thermaic Gulf, the capital of the second division of Macedonia and the residence of a Roman governor and quaestor from Thessalos (a Thessalian) and 3529; Thessalonice, a place in Asia Minor: KJV -- Thessalonica. see GREEK for 3529 |
